AC Milan could spoil Arsenal’s plans to keep winger

Arsenal is keen to keep Reiss Nelson beyond this season and are in talks to offer the attacker a new contract.

Nelson has been a fringe player for most of his time on their books, but he has made some telling contributions off the bench in this campaign.

Those contributions have made Arsenal open to the idea of keeping him beyond his current deal.

However, as he enters the final two months of his contract, several clubs are keen to add him to their squad.

One of them is AC Milan, with the Italian side considering him a fine free agent to sign.

They have targeted Folarin Balogun this term and Nelson is the second Arsenal player that they want to sign, according to Calciomercato.
